In-State vs Out-of-State Tuition

The Landing School is listed as Private nonprofit in the local dataset. In-state tuition is $27,700 and out-of-state tuition is $27,700. The reported in-state and out-of-state tuition values match in this dataset.

International Student and Private College Tuition Note

The local database lists The Landing School as Private nonprofit. Private colleges commonly report one tuition rate rather than separate resident and nonresident rates. In this dataset, The Landing School reports $27,700 for out-of-state tuition and $27,700 for in-state tuition. International student billing, visa expenses, health insurance and aid eligibility should be verified directly with the school.

Average Net Price After Aid

Based on available data, the average student at The Landing School pays approximately $24,342 per year after grants and aid. This is above the Maine average of $18,022 and above the national average of $17,506.

Financial Aid and Scholarships

About 20.00% of The Landing School students receive federal Pell grants, indicating the share of students receiving this need-based aid in the local dataset. 44.44% take federal loans, which helps families understand borrowing patterns alongside net price.

Accreditation

The Landing School lists Accrediting Commission of Career Schools and Colleges as its accreditor in the local dataset. Institutional accreditation is an important trust signal and can affect federal financial aid eligibility. Accreditation means an external agency has reviewed academic quality and institutional standards, which helps families verify whether federal aid pathways such as Pell grants and federal loans may apply.
